There is something sacred about watching a friend pour her heart into a place she loves.
Today, we celebrate Missy Bogard—Cotter resident, fly-fishing guide, artist, and a cherished friend of our community. Many know Missy from her days on the river, sharing her passion for fly fishing with anglers from near and far, or from welcoming visitors through the doors of Diamond State Fly Co. But when she steps away from the water, her creativity finds another current to follow.
As she brings her artwork to life here at Catch & Release, we are reminded that the same spirit that guides her on the river flows through her brush. Her work reflects a deep love for this place, for the outdoors, and for the people who call the Trout Capital of the USA home.
We are profoundly grateful for the gifts Missy shares with our town—not only her talent, but her generosity, kindness, and commitment to inspiring others. As a female artist and guide, she leads by example, showing young creatives and outdoor enthusiasts alike that there is room to follow both passion and purpose.
May her work encourage others to create boldly, explore freely, and find beauty in the waters, landscapes, and communities that shape us.
Thank you, Missy, for sharing your vision with us and for helping tell the story of Cotter through your art. We are honored to call you our friend and grateful to welcome your work into the heart of our community.
